Just outside the village of Rostrevor, Co. Down, Rostrevor Holidays is situated in the foothills of the Mourne Mountains. With fantastic views across the mountains and down to Carlingford Lough, the self-catering accommodation is suitable for those looking for a relaxing break, or for families looking for somewhere to let their kids explore the outdoors.

Our clean and cosy three bedroom cottages, sleep up to six people. In Tieveodockarragh, Slieve Martin, and Cnoc Si, a combined kitchen/living area, with an open log fire, is perfect for family get togethers, or somewhere to relax with your friends after a long day walking or mountain biking in the Mournes. There is a separate bathroom, WC, and shower room, so no need to worry about queues. The cottages have all facilities, including washer/dryer, and a dishwasher. Oil fired central heating is included in the price. We can provide cots and highchairs if needed.

The “Ceili House” has a large living/dining room with a Liscannor stone floor, suitable for entertaining larger groups. There is a separate fully equipped kitchen. Sleeping arrangements are three twin rooms, two of which are ensuite. Please request further information, as the accommodation may not be suitable for toddlers or the less able.

On site, there is also plenty to do. We have a children’s playground, and the tennis court is always popular for those wanting to show off their competitive side. For somewhere to get away for a picnic or to get closer to nature, we have a two kilometres riverside/farm trail. This brings you right around the farm on which Rostrevor Holidays is situated, and runs along the Yellow Water River.

In 2015 Rostrevor Holidays were awarded a Bronze Award in the Green Tourism Business Scheme.
